So once Dave let us know he had taken the photos of the shorty Voyager and that he had tossed the photos into the Flickr pool of Tastelessly or Strangely Modified Vehicles, well, there went my afternoon. As with many other aspects of life, one man’s trash is another man’s treasure, and I certainly treasured some of the photos in the pool, like Hugo90’s photos of the Monte (2, 3) taken at the 2007 Portland, Oregon, Microcar and Minicar Meet. According to Hugo’s captions, the Monte was built in California in the 1960s from an American Ford rear end, a British Ford front and a Wisconsin one-cylinder engine.

tastelesslyorstrangelymodifiedcars_02_resized.jpg

And, of course, shorty vehicles abound in the pool, including this shorty Mini, also photographed by Hugo90, but in 1974 in Melbourne, advertising a place called Mini World.
